29款CSS3页面加载动画特效Loaders.css源码库

版权申诉
0 下载量 118 浏览量 更新于2024-11-25 收藏 32KB ZIP 举报
资源摘要信息:"纯CSS3实现的29款超全页面加载loading动画库Loaders.css特效源码.zip" 知识点: 1. CSS3技术:CSS3是层叠样式表(Cascading Style Sheets)的最新版本,为Web开发带来了许多增强的功能和模块。CSS3为网页添加图形化元素提供了更加丰富的工具,包括阴影、过渡效果、圆角边框、动画和更多的选择器,而无需使用图片或JavaScript。它是现代网页设计和开发中不可或缺的技术之一。 2. 页面加载动画:在Web开发中,页面加载动画是用户体验设计的重要部分。它们通常用于在页面内容加载时给用户一个视觉反馈,告知用户数据正在加载中。这些动画可以减少用户的等待焦虑,增强页面的专业感和趣味性。 3. Loading动画库:Loading动画库是收集了多种加载动画样式的集合,通常是为了给网页设计师和开发者提供方便的解决方案,以便他们可以快速地为自己的网页添加具有吸引力的加载动画。这些动画库可以包含大量的预设动画效果,使设计师能够轻松选择并集成到项目中。 4. Loaders.css特效:Loaders.css特效指的是一个特定的CSS库,用于创建动画加载器。这个库可能包含预设的CSS样式,开发者可以直接应用到HTML元素上,从而实现各种加载动画。通常,这些样式都是易于使用的,并且无需额外的JavaScript代码。 5. 文件压缩:文件压缩是一种减少文件大小的技术,以便于存储和传输。通常有无损压缩和有损压缩两种类型,无损压缩不会丢失任何信息,而有损压缩可能会减少文件的部分信息以达到更高的压缩比。在这个案例中,"压缩包子"文件应该是一个压缩包的名称,其中包含了29款CSS3加载动画的源码。 6. 动画效果的实现方法:在CSS3中,实现动画效果主要依赖于@keyframes规则和animation属性。@keyframes定义动画序列,它指定了动画的名称和每个阶段的关键帧。animation属性则用于设置动画的具体参数,如时长、延时、重复次数、动画曲线等。通过这些属性的组合,开发者能够创建平滑且多样化的动画效果。 7. 响应式设计:在创建加载动画时,设计师和开发者还需要考虑到响应式设计的原则。响应式设计意味着页面元素能够根据不同的屏幕尺寸和分辨率进行适应,以确保在任何设备上都能提供良好的用户体验。CSS3通过媒体查询(Media Queries)、弹性布局(Flexbox)和网格布局(Grid)等工具来实现响应式设计。 总结:本资源包中包含的"纯CSS3实现的29款超全页面加载loading动画库Loaders.css特效源码",为开发者提供了一整套无需JavaScript的加载动画解决方案。通过这些CSS3代码,开发者能够快速集成多样化的加载动画效果,从而提升用户在内容加载期间的体验,并且可以确保动画效果在不同设备上都能良好工作。此外,文件压缩技术的运用使得这些丰富的资源可以更加容易地管理和分享。